Как считать эксель в Питон с помощью простого кода: руководство для начинающих

Как считать эксель в питон

Для считывания Excel-файлов в Питоне мы можем использовать библиотеку pandas. Вот пример кода:


import pandas as pd

# Указываем путь к файлу Excel
path = 'путь_к_вашему_файлу.xlsx'

# Используем функцию read_excel, чтобы считать данные из файла
df = pd.read_excel(path)

# Выводим данные
print(df)

В этом примере мы импортируем библиотеку pandas и используем функцию read_excel для считывания данных из файла Excel. Путь к файлу нужно заменить соответствующим путем на вашем компьютере. Затем мы сохраняем данные в переменную df и выводим их на экран.

Таким образом, вы сможете считать данные из файла Excel в Питоне, используя библиотеку pandas.

Детальный ответ

Как считать эксель в питон

Приветствую! В этой статье я подробно расскажу, как считывать данные из файлов формата Excel в языке программирования Python. Это навык, который может быть очень полезен при работе с большими объемами данных и автоматизации различных процессов. Мы будем использовать библиотеку pandas, которая предоставляет удобные инструменты для работы с данными.

Установка библиотеки pandas

Перед тем, как начать, необходимо установить библиотеку pandas. Для этого выполните следующую команду в командной строке:

pip install pandas

Подготовка Excel-файла

Прежде чем приступить к чтению данных из файла, необходимо убедиться, что у вас есть Excel-файл, с которым вы собираетесь работать. Убедитесь, что у вас есть путь к этому файлу, и его формат соответствует формату .xlsx.

Чтение данных из Excel с помощью pandas

Теперь, когда у нас есть установленная библиотека и подготовленный файл, мы можем приступить к чтению данных. Вот пример кода:

import pandas as pd

# Укажите путь к вашему файлу Excel
path = 'путь_к_файлу.xlsx'

# Считывание данных
data = pd.read_excel(path)

# Вывод данных
print(data)

В этом примере мы импортируем библиотеку pandas и указываем путь к файлу Excel, который мы хотим прочитать. Затем мы используем функцию read_excel(), которая считывает данные из файла и возвращает их в виде объекта DataFrame, особенного типа данных, предоставляемого библиотекой pandas для работы с табличными данными.

Наконец, мы просто выводим данные с помощью функции print(). Вы можете видеть ваши данные в консоли после запуска этого кода.

Дополнительные возможности

Pandas предоставляет множество возможностей для работы с данными формата Excel. Ниже приведены некоторые полезные функции, которые могут вам понадобиться:

  • to_excel(): сохранение данных в файл формата Excel.
  • head(): вывод первых нескольких строк данных.
  • tail(): вывод последних нескольких строк данных.
  • shape: получение размера DataFrame (количество строк и столбцов).
  • columns: получение списка названий столбцов.

Обратите внимание, что это лишь некоторые из возможностей, предоставляемых библиотекой pandas. Вам стоит ознакомиться с официальной документацией, чтобы узнать о всех функциях и методах, которые позволяют работать с данными формата Excel.

Заключение

Теперь вы знаете, как считывать данные из файлов формата Excel в языке программирования Python с использованием библиотеки pandas. Этот навык может быть очень полезен при анализе данных и автоматизации рабочих процессов. Постарайтесь практиковать его на реальных данных, чтобы лучше усвоить материал.

Удачи в вашем программировании!

Видео по теме

Чтение данных из Excel файла в Python. Библиотека openpyxl в Python

Уроки Python / Работа с файлами Excel считываем данные и формулы

Добавление данных в excel таблицу с помощью python

Похожие статьи:

Как научиться программированию на Python: советы и шаги

Как объединить список списков в список python: легкое руководство с примерами и краткой справкой 🐍🔗

Как отсортировать список в Python в порядке убывания? 📋🔽

Как считать эксель в Питон с помощью простого кода: руководство для начинающих

🔄 Как вернуть программу на начало ввода python?

Как определить количество предложений в тексте с помощью Python?

Какой параметр обязательно принимает в себя метод экземпляра класса Python?